2010-09-04 19 views
6

Pregunta simple, soy nuevo en el uso de node.js y tenía curiosidad sobre cómo debo identificar de manera única una computadora.¿Cómo podría identificar de manera única una computadora en node.js?

+0

Básicamente, ¿cómo puedo hacer sesiones en Node.js es realmente lo que estoy pidiendo. Porque si un usuario tiene dos pestañas, abre en su id del navegador web como esas pestañas para interactuar también. – Travis

+2

¿Está solicitando solicitudes HTTP? Si es así, intente usar una cookie. Vea esta pregunta: http://stackoverflow.com/questions/3393854/get-and-set-a-single-cookie-with-node-js-http-server –

+0

Supongo que es una solicitud de http ya ... I ' m trabajando con websockets – Travis

Respuesta

2

Al igual que con la mayoría de las operaciones que no hay manera de identificar de forma única una computadora. Todos los datos se envían sin estado y sin ninguna información de la computadora.

Pero puede cambiar su (x) aplicación html para almacenar cookies únicas para que la parte del cliente pueda autenticarse en el servidor con la cookie, identificando perfectamente dos pestañas abiertas de un usuario.

Cuestiones relacionadas